Thyssen
Bornemisza Museum
Collection initiated towards 1920 by the father of the
actual Baron Thyssen, who extend it throughout his life
until turning it in one of the greater painting private
collections of the world. In October of 1992, the museum
was inaugurated after an agreement made between Baron
Thyssen and the Spanish state. Among the remarkable art
works are paintings of Raphael, Durero, Tiziano, Tintoretto,
Ribera, Picasso, Miró and Pollock, among others,
in addition to impressionists and expressionists works.
